Laverne McClellan Obituary

Mrs. LaVerne Wilkes McClellan died peacefully at home in Marietta, GA in the early hours of Saturday,January 11, 2020 at the age of 92. She was deeply loved by her friends and family and will be missed by all.
She is survived by her children Linda Hardenbrook (Bret), Atlanta, GA and Lamar McClellan (Sandi), Columbus, GA; siblings Jacqueline Crot, Niceville, FL and Buddy Wilkes (Diane), Niceville, FL; grandchildren Gina Yancey (Rich), Marietta, GA, Ellan Deinlein (Donald), Birmingham, AL, Karen Lee McLaney (Mike), Slidell, LA, Jennifer Talley, Auburn, AL, and Rodney Campbell (Tammy) Smiths, AL; and many great-grandchildren, great-great-grandchildren, nieces, and nephews. She was predeceased by her husband of 63 years Lex P. McClellan, and siblings Alvin C. Wilkes, William T. Wilkes, Dottie Wilkes Gunter, Jerry B. Wilkes, and Kathy Wilkes Gott.
LaVerne was born on November 3, 1927 in Columbus, GA to William Jennings Bryan Wilkes, Sr. and Katie Rhodes Wilkes. As a tenth grader during WWII her family moved to Brunswick, GA where she worked as a welder in Jones Shipyard building Liberty ships for the war effort, one of the millions of "Rosie the Riveters" who proudly contributed to the war effort at home while the war was being fought overseas. Her story, written by her, is chronicled in a book about Rosie the Riveters. It was during this time that she developed a strong patriotism which she exhibited throughout her life.
One of LaVerne's major accomplishments was that she, in her 40s, went to Columbus State University Nursing School, graduating at the top of her class as an RN.
After several years of travel related to Lex's Navy career the family returned to the Phenix City/Columbus area where they lived most of their lives. LaVerne and Lex were active and dedicated members of Pierce Chapel United Methodist Church for many years.
Her interests included writing poetry and short stories, quilting and raising roses. Friends were often surprised by a bouquet freshly cut from her garden. Watching sports (Braves, NASCAR, college football, and golf) was another of her favorite activities. She was an avid fan of Auburn University, the alma mater of both her children. She was, however, most happy when on special occasions she was surrounded by family and loved ones.
